Nobody does it better… or bigger
America (land of the free, home of the shakes) is the fast-food capital of the world. Of the 25 largest fast-food chains globally, 22 come from the United States, with every single one of the top 17 being American-owned.
Convenient, usually cheap, and always delicious, fast food is a familiar favorite for many — and it’s become even more familiar in the last year. Indeed, with groceries getting more expensive than ever before, sales at many of the largest chains have soared.
In the last 12 months, the net profits for 6 of the largest public fast-food chains in the country have totaled nearly $16bn, over 30% higher than the group achieved at the same point in 2019.
